What Is Cl In Goats

What Is Cl In Goats - It is commonly found in goats and in sheep, and sporadically in horses, cattle, camelids, swine, fowl, and even people. Web cl = caseous lymphadenitis : A chronic, contagious bacterial infection characterized by abscesses near the lymph nodes, usually on the neck or near the udder. Prevalent on all continents throughout the world, cl causes ulcerative lymphadenitis in horses and superficial abscesses in bovines, swine, rabbits, deer, laboratory animals, and humans. Caseous lymphadenitis (cl) is a chronically infectious disease of sheep and goats that is caused by the bacterium corynebacterium pseudotuberculosis. Web caseous lymphadenitis of sheep and goats november 10, 2022 caseous lymphadenitis (cl, occasionally abbreviated cla) is a bacterial infection caused by corynebacterium pseudotuberculosis resulting in superficial or internal abscesses and recurrent development of abscesses.
